Walgreens
25 mile radius of Marrero, LA
yesterday
Marrero, LA, US
New Orleans, LA, US
New Orleans, LA, US
New Orleans, LA, US
Metairie, LA, US
Meraux, LA, US
Gretna, LA, US
Gretna, LA, US
Meraux, LA, US
New Orleans, LA, US